Title: Dynamical fragmentation of C sub 60 ions

The distribution of fragments resulting from collisions between 50--200-keV C{sub 60}{sup +} ions and H{sub 2} and He is found to follow approximately a simple power law {ital I}({ital m})={ital cp}{sup {ital m}} where {ital p} is a constant depending on both energy and target gas, and {ital m} is the number of missing pairs'' of carbon atoms. Based on this observation, a new dynamical fragmentation model involving the ratio of two characteristic times is proposed. In collisions by 300-keV C{sub 60}{sup ++} ions, the singly charged products are distributed quite differently, which implies the first evidence of the presence of charge-separation reactions.
